Elemental Mercury (Hg0): Sources, Uses, and Risks

Elemental mercury, often denoted as Hg0, is derived from natural processes like volcanic activity and mineral weathering, though large volumes are emitted through mining activities. Historically, it was used a function in medical applications and old thermometers, while currently it finds application in compact lighting, quick-filled switches, and some niche chemical reactions. However, Hg0 poses considerable health dangers due to its vaporization; inhalation of quicksilver vapor can impair the brain system, and planetary impact can occur from spillage into rivers and ground.
